        Munters AB is a Swedish public company established in 1955 with 5,153 employees. The company specializes in air treatment and humidity control solutions.

        MERSEN

        Mersen is a French public company founded in 1889 with 7,153 employees. The company manufactures electrical protection and thermal management solutions.

        MODINE MANUFACTURING COMPANY

        Modine Manufacturing Company is a United States-based public company founded in 1916 with 13,200 employees. The company designs and manufactures thermal management systems for various industries.

        NORSK HYDRO ASA

        Norsk Hydro ASA is a Norwegian public company established in 1905 with 32,786 employees. The company is a major integrated aluminum and energy producer.

        Market Definition

        The plate & frame heat exchanger comprises the global industry involved in the design, manufacturing, distribution, and maintenance of heat exchangers that utilize a series of corrugated metal plates clamped together within a frame to transfer heat between two fluids. These systems offer high thermal efficiency, compact size, and flexibility, making them ideal for applications across HVAC & refrigeration, chemical, petrochemical and oil & gas, food & beverage, power generation, pulp & paper, and other applications. Plate & frame heat exchangers are characterized by their modularity, ease of cleaning and maintenance, and superior performance in low-to-medium pressure and temperature operations. The market is driven by the increasing demand for energy-efficient heat transfer systems, tightening environmental regulations, and the expanding industrial infrastructure in emerging economies. Technological advancements, such as gasketed, brazed, and welded variants, further diversify their applications and adoption.
